22-07-2006, 14:54
|
#25
|
|
Senior Member
Iscritto dal: Jun 2002
Città:
Provincia De VaRéSe ~ § ~ Lat.: 45° 51' 7" N Long.: 8° 50' 21" E ~§~ Magica Inter ~ § ~ Detto: A Chi Più Amiamo Meno Dire Sappiamo ~ § ~ ~ § ~ Hobby: Divertimento allo Stato Puro ~ § ~ ~ § ~ You Must Go Out ~ § ~
Messaggi: 8896
|
Quote:
|
Originariamente inviato da andbin
Se deve fare solo una semplice sottrazione è invece più semplice la sottrazione digit x digit.
Non so se conosci l'assembly x86. Questa è una somma su 96 bit in precisione multipla:
Codice:
MOV EAX,[ESI+0]
ADD [EDI+0],EAX
MOV EAX,[ESI+4]
ADC [EDI+4],EAX
MOV EAX,[ESI+8]
ADC [EDI+8],EAX
(supponendo che ESI punti al operando1 e EDI punti al operando2/destinazione).
Prova a scriverla in "C" puro. 
|
mi fai sempre + paura anche te
~§~ Sempre E Solo Lei ~§~
__________________
Meglio essere protagonisti della propria tragedia che spettatori della propria vita
Si dovrebbe pensare più a far bene che a stare bene: e così si finirebbe anche a star meglio.
Non preoccuparti solo di essere migliore dei tuoi contemporanei o dei tuoi predecessori.Cerca solo di essere migliore di te stesso
|
|
|